Two identical conducting balls having unequal positive charges q₁ and q₂ are separated by a distance r . If they are made to touch each other and then separated to the same distance, the force between them will be
Options
- Azero
- BMore than before
- CSame as before
- DLess than before
Correct answer
B. More than before
Step-by-step solution
Initial force: F₁ = k q₁ q₂ r^2 After touching, each ball gets charge q' = q₁+q₂ 2 New force: F₂ = k ( q₁+q₂ 2 )^2 r^2 Comparing: since q₁ q₂ , (q₁-q₂)^2 > 0 (q₁+q₂)^2 > 4q₁q₂ ( q₁+q₂ 2 )^2 > q₁q₂ F₂ > F₁ , the force is more than before.
